Quote:
Originally Posted by Ricochet View Post
At this time Jake is a very good TE not elite but he's not to far off from being special and if the talk of Will Yeatman giving up football ends up being true then ND will bring in 2 TE's again in '09.
---I beg to differ about Golic not being elite. Do you know many TE's already in the '09 class that are studs? I haven't heard of one you're just assuming that because it's a Golic and a legacy. It's been widely thought of that Jake is the better ath. and may have the better future in football than that of Mike. One thing is for certain though with that family they will work their asses off for ND football and I don't see us taking anybody next year but Jake. We most likely will not take 2 next year even if and yes it's a big IF because one website speculated it and there's nothing to back it up. Weis has said he will use a pattern of 2-1-2-1-2 when taking TE's year to year. Just because Yeatman stops playing doesn't mean Charlie wants to overstock and take 4 TE's in 2 years. Especially if Fauria redshirts which is a good possibility because he needs to bulk up. I'll be more than happy to take Jake the Snake next year.
